I think setup a security mailing list for Flink is pretty nice although `
secur...@apache.org` can be used and the report will be forwarded to Flink
private mailing list if there is no project specific security mailing
list. One thing that is pretty sure is that we should guide users on how to
report security issues in Flink website as security vulnerabilities should
not be entered into a project's public bug tracker directly according to
the guidance for how to handling the security vulnerabilities in ASF
site[1].

Besides, we need also add a security page in Flink which shows the
information about the security vulnerabilities per the guidance of the
security vulnerabilities in ASF site[2]. Projects such as spark[3],
kafka[4], etc already have such a page.

> I'm reaching out to see if there is an existing security specific mailing
> list in Flink. If there is, we should expose it in the offcial web site of
> Flink [1] to guide people to report security issues to this mailing list.
> If it still doesn't exist, I'm here to propose to setup a
> secur...@flink.apache.org mailing list for reporting and discussion of
> security specific issues. Currently, most well known apache projects such
> as apache common[2], hadoop[3], spark[4], kafka[5], hive[6], etc have a
> security specific mailing list. It would be nice if there is also a
> security specific mailing list for Flink.
>
> Note that users should report security issues to the security mailing
> list.
